1. What Are Cookies?

Cookies are small text files placed on your device by websites you visit. They are widely used to make websites work efficiently, provide analytics information, and enable advertising functionality. Similar technologies include pixel tags, web beacons, local storage, and device fingerprinting.

5. Do Not Track (DNT) Signals

Some browsers transmit "Do Not Track" (DNT) signals. Currently, there is no industry standard for how websites should respond to DNT signals. We treat DNT signals as equivalent to opting out of non-essential cookies.
